SAN FRANCISCO - Golden State Warriors star Kevin Durant on Tuesday apologized for exchanges with fans on Twitter about his departure from the Oklahoma City Thunder, branding his comments "childish" and "idiotic".
Durant, appearing on a Tech Crunch panel in San Francisco, said he regretted posting remarks that cited former coach Billy Donovan and teammate Russell Westbrook.
The NBA Finals MVP was caught out on Twitter after using his official account on the social-media site to reply to comments from a fan asking why he had left Oklahoma City.
